Speed Master: Monster is not capitalized, monster is only capitalized when used in "Effect Monster","Normal Monster","Ritual Monster", or "Fusion Monster." When used alone it is not capitalized. Use a comma, not a period between monsters and increase. Don't use points after ATK, simply use ATK. Summoned is not capitalized by itself, only in "Special Summoned," "Normal Summoned," Tribute Summoned," etc. Only use 1 question mark in the ATK and DEF.
